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_001012264.4(RNASE13):​c.371A>G​(p.Tyr124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00046 in 1,614,032 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. 17/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
RNASE13 (HGNC:25285): (ribonuclease A family member 13 (inactive)) Predicted to enable nucleic acid binding activity. Predicted to be located in extracellular region. [provided by Alliance of Genome Resources, Apr 2022]
NDRG2 (HGNC:14460): (NDRG family member 2) This gene is a member of the N-myc downregulated gene family which belongs to the alpha/beta hydrolase superfamily. The protein encoded by this gene is a cytoplasmic protein that may play a role in neurite outgrowth. This gene may be involved in glioblastoma carcinogenesis.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2017]
TPPP2 (HGNC:19293): (tubulin polymerization promoting protein family member 2) Enables tubulin binding activity. Involved in regulation of flagellated sperm motility. Located in cytosol. [provided by Alliance of Genome Resources, Apr 2022]
